Do you sometimes feel like you’re living with a roommate instead of a lover? Conversations feel flat, nights are quiet, and intimacy feels more like obligation than joy. You’re not alone—and the good news is, it doesn’t have to stay this way. Passion and connection can be reignited, and you can feel alive in your relationship again.
Over time, routines and responsibilities can quietly push couples into a “roommate” mode. Work, family, and daily stress create a cycle where emotional closeness and physical desire slip away. Recognizing this early is the first step to reversing it.
